Bonnaroo Announces 2013 Lineup Including Mumford & Sons, Bjork, Wilco and More

“Weird Al” Yankovic hosted a special one-hour live webcast to unveil the 2013 Bonnaroo Festival lineup, held June 13-16, 2013 in Manchester, TN.

Paul McCartney,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ers, and Mumford and Sons will be headlining this year’s edition, along with Bjork, Wilco, Pretty Lights and many others.

Tickets (4 day price admission with parking/camping) go on sale Saturday, February 23rd at 12 Noon EST via bonnaroo.com. Tickets are $26.30 per ticket with a $6 service charge. Price Level 1 is already sold out.
